Queens is NYC's most diverse borough with an incredibly varied housing stock — from attached row houses in Astoria and Jackson Heights to single-family homes in Bayside and Fresh Meadows. This diversity means varied pest challenges: the dense residential-commercial corridors of Flushing and Jamaica face cockroach and rodent pressure, while the more suburban neighborhoods of eastern Queens deal with ants, mosquitoes, and occasional wildlife issues.

What pest problems are common in Queens?
Queens residents deal with cockroaches in apartment buildings, ants in single-family homes and row houses, rodents especially in areas near commercial corridors, and mosquitoes in neighborhoods with yards and green spaces.

Is pest control different for Queens homes vs. apartments?
Single-family homes require more exterior exclusion work and seasonal pest prevention. Apartments require building-wide coordination. Our IPM programs are tailored to each property type.

What should I do about rats in my Queens neighborhood?
Contact your landlord or property manager if you rent. Report rat activity to 311 for public spaces. Schedule professional exclusion and trapping for your property. Building-wide treatment is most effective.
